Computer Support

Computer support roles are common starting points in an IT career. These roles involve supporting various aspects of computer operations. With experience, individuals can specialize in fields like cybersecurity or networks. Some possible job titles in computer support include IT support technician, desktop support technician, and help desk technician. Entry-level IT certifications can be beneficial but are not always required for these roles.

If you’re looking to kickstart your IT career, computer support jobs provide a foundational knowledge of systems and troubleshooting. As an IT support technician, you’ll assist individuals with technical issues, diagnose problems, and provide solutions to ensure smooth computer operations across an organization.

Desktop support technicians, on the other hand, focus on providing hands-on assistance with hardware and software installations, upgrades, and repairs. Their expertise includes configuring operating systems, setting up networks, and resolving technical glitches.

Help desk technicians play a pivotal role in resolving technical problems faced by end-users. They provide prompt assistance, offer troubleshooting guidance, and escalate complex issues when necessary. Help desk technicians are excellent problem-solvers with exceptional communication skills.

While certifications like CompTIA A+, Microsoft Certified Desktop Support Technician (MCDST), or HDI Desktop Support Technician can enhance your credentials, they aren’t always mandatory for entry-level computer support positions. Instead, employers prioritize hands-on experience and a passion for technology.

Cybersecurity

The field of cybersecurity plays a vital role in the IT industry. As a cybersecurity professional, you will be responsible for protecting computer systems, devices, and valuable information from various threats, such as malware and unauthorized access.

Careers in cybersecurity offer exciting opportunities to make a significant impact and ensure the security of organizations and individuals in the digital world. Some of the job roles in this field include information security analyst, cybersecurity analyst, and cybersecurity engineer.

The demand for cybersecurity professionals is rapidly growing, with a projected job growth rate of 35 percent in the coming years. This growth indicates the importance of cybersecurity skills in today’s technology-driven world and makes it a promising career path for aspiring IT professionals.

To kickstart a career in cybersecurity, obtaining relevant certifications can be immensely beneficial. Entry-level certifications like CompTIA Security+ or Certified Information Systems Auditor (CISA) provide a solid foundation and demonstrate your expertise and commitment to the field.

Cybersecurity Certifications Comparison

To help you navigate the world of cybersecurity certifications, we have compiled a comparison table highlighting some popular certifications:

Certification Provider Level Focus Areas
CompTIA Security+ CompTIA Entry-level General cybersecurity knowledge and skills
Certified Information Systems Auditor (CISA) ISACA Intermediate Audit, control, and security of information systems
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P) (ISC)² Advanced Wide range of security domains and best practices

It’s important to research and choose certifications that align with your career goals and areas of interest within cybersecurity.

Networks and Systems

Network and systems professionals play a vital role in managing and maintaining the infrastructure that keeps organizations connected and running smoothly. These professionals are responsible for overseeing network-related tasks, handling hardware, and ensuring optimal performance.

Within the field of networks and systems, there are various roles available, including:

  • Network Administrator
  • Systems Administrator
  • Network Implementation Technician
  • Systems Analyst

Network and systems professionals often start their careers as analysts or administrators, gaining experience and knowledge in their respective domains. With time and expertise, they can progress to higher-level positions such as network engineer or systems engineer.

Network and Systems Certifications

Obtaining relevant certifications is crucial for network and systems professionals to demonstrate their skills and expertise. These certifications validate their knowledge and can significantly enhance career prospects. Some notable certifications in this field include:

Certification Description
CompTIA Server+ A certification that validates skills in server hardware and software technologies.
Cisco Certified Network Associate (CCNA) A widely recognized certification that showcases proficiency in Cisco networking solutions.

Web Development

If you have a passion for creating and maintaining websites and phone applications, a career in web development may be the perfect fit for you. Web developers play a critical role in designing and building the online presence of businesses and organizations.

Web developers can specialize in different areas, such as front-end development, back-end development, or choose to work as full-stack developers, handling both the client-side and server-side aspects of web development. By honing your skills in these areas, you can become a valuable asset to any digital team.

Some of the common job titles in web development include:

  • Web Developer: Responsible for writing clean and efficient code to create functional websites and applications.
  • Web Designer: Focuses on the visual aspects of a website, creating attractive and user-friendly interfaces.
  • Front-end Developer: Deals with the user-facing elements of a website, ensuring its responsiveness and interactivity.
  • Back-end Developer: Concentrates on the server-side of web development, managing databases and implementing complex functionalities.

Proficiency in web programming languages is crucial for success in this field. Some of the widely used languages include Python, JavaScript, CSS, and HTML. These languages allow you to create dynamic and interactive websites that deliver a seamless user experience.

Projected Job Growth for Web Development

The web development industry is experiencing rapid growth, with a projected job growth rate of 23 percent [6]. As businesses continue to focus on their online presence, the demand for skilled web developers is expected to remain high.

Data

The field of data analysis holds promising career opportunities in the IT industry. As a data professional, you will be tasked with working with large volumes of data to uncover valuable insights and patterns. Job titles in this field include data analyst, data scientist, and data engineer. By obtaining data analytics certifications, you can enhance your skills and increase your employability. Notable certifications in data analytics include the IBM Data Analyst Professional Certificate and the Google Data Analytics Professional Certificate.

data analytics certifications

These certifications provide a comprehensive understanding of data analytics techniques and tools, preparing you for the challenges of the role. They cover various topics such as data visualization, statistical analysis, and machine learning. By earning these certifications, you demonstrate your dedication to the field and showcase your expertise to potential employers.

The demand for data professionals is growing steadily, with a projected job growth of 9 percent [7]. This indicates a wealth of opportunities for individuals pursuing a career in data analysis. Data Analytics Certification Comparison

Certification Provider Duration Skill Coverage
IBM Data Analyst Professional Certificate IBM 6 months Data visualization, SQL, Python, data analysis
Google Data Analytics Professional Certificate Google 6 months Data analysis, data visualization, data cleaning, Python, SQL

What education is needed for a career in information technology?

The education requirements for IT careers can vary depending on the specific role. Some entry-level positions, such as computer support roles, may only require a high school diploma or an associate degree in a related field. However, higher-level positions, such as cybersecurity or software development, often require a bachelor’s degree in a relevant discipline.

What is data in the IT field?

In the IT field, data refers to large amounts of information that organizations collect, store, and analyze to gain insights and support decision-making processes. Data professionals work with this data, finding patterns and trends to drive business strategies.

What are the job titles in data?

Job titles in the data field include data analyst, data scientist, and data engineer. Data analysts analyze data to identify trends and patterns, data scientists use advanced algorithms and machine learning techniques to extract insights, and data engineers design and maintain data storage and processing systems.

What certifications are beneficial for a career in data?

Certifications in data analytics, such as the IBM Data Analyst Professional Certificate and Google Data Analytics Professional Certificate, can provide the necessary skills and knowledge for a career in data. Other valuable certifications include Certified Data Management Professional (CDMP) and Cloudera Certified Data Engineer (CCDE).
